Financial Program vs. Enterprise Resource Planning: Selecting the Right Fit
Many growing companies struggle deciding whether financial software or a full-fledged Enterprise Resource Planning solution is appropriate. Accounting programs typically focus on basic economic handling tasks, like billing, vendor payments, and analysis. However, ERP solutions deliver a much broader scope of functionality, linking areas like stock management, customer relationship management, and personnel. Ultimately, the correct option relies on your company’s size, sophistication, and future expansion goals.

ERP Software: Beyond Accounting, A Comprehensive Approach
Many companies still consider ERP software primarily as a advanced accounting system , but the reality is it represents a far more extensive framework. Today’s ERP platforms offer a complete approach to streamlining numerous aspects of a company's processes, from inventory handling and logistics to staff oversight and customer relationship management . This interconnected methodology enables greater insight and efficiency across the entire enterprise .
